Air Canada reported record full-year revenue of $22.3 billion in 2024, a 2% increase on a 5% capacity growth, with adjusted EBITDA of $3.6 billion, slightly above guidance.
The company achieved significant operational improvements, including an 8-point gain in on-time performance and a new pilot agreement without major disruptions.
Forward-looking targets for 2028 include $30 billion in operating revenues, at least a 17% adjusted EBITDA margin, and approximately 5% free cash flow margin.
Air Canada is proactively adjusting capacity, particularly in U.S. leisure markets, while seeing strong demand in transatlantic and sun markets for Q2 and Q3 of 2025.
The company remains focused on disciplined capital allocation, including share buybacks and fleet investments, while maintaining flexibility to adapt to external pressures like fuel costs and currency fluctuations.
